一、基本用法
letter-spacing属性的基本用法非常简单。以下是一些实例:
/* 像素值 */ p { letter-spacing: 2px; } /* 百分比 */ h1 { letter-spacing: 1.2%; } /* em值 */ h2 { letter-spacing: 0.5em; }
在上面的实例中,letter-spacing属性被用于调整文本中字符之间的间距。在第一个实例中,字符之间的间距为2px,在第二个实例中字符之间的间距为1.2%在第三个实例中,字符之间的间距为0.5em。
二、调整字符间距的方法
1.像素值
使用像素值作为letter-spacing值时,您可以选择任意值来增加或减少字符之间的间距。
p { letter-spacing: 2px; }
2.百分比
使用百分比作为letter-spacing值时,间距的大小会根据字体大小而变化。
h1 { letter-spacing: 1.2%; }
3.em
使用em作为letter-spacing值时,间距的大小根据当前字体大小而变化。这使得em成为一个非常有用的度量单位,因为它可以随着文本的放大或缩小而变化。
h2 { letter-spacing: 0.5em; }
三、letter-spacing的使用场景
1. 大标题
在大标题中使用letter-spacing是非常普遍的。通过增加字符之间的间距,可以使标题更具有吸引力。
这是一个大标题
2.导航栏
使用letter-spacing可以将导航菜单中的文本字符之间的间距增加,这会使整个导航栏看起来更加井然有序。
.nav-item { letter-spacing: 1.2px; }
3.打印文本
在打印文本时,调整字符之间的间距可以使文本更容易阅读。
@media print { p { letter-spacing: 1.5px; } }
四、注意事项
有一些注意事项需要注意:
- 不要过度使用letter-spacing,否则会使文本难以阅读
- 在设计响应式页面时,使用百分比或em作为letter-spacing值
在本文中,我们已经详细地讨论了letter-spacing属性,包括其用法、示例以及注意事项。希望这篇文章能帮助您更好地理解letter-spacing属性的使用。